Output 31a3c51e798ba775a385fe80f0796c8f90632db1969b7e28bde4356b9c03a921:6

value
18295
script pubkey
OP_0 OP_PUSHBYTES_20 ddfd6e6cb39ddbcd694b76900be53181f802bf91
address
bc1qmh7kum9nnhdu662tw6gqhef3s8uq90u3u9muy9
transaction
31a3c51e798ba775a385fe80f0796c8f90632db1969b7e28bde4356b9c03a921